Lets Play Blog Tagging

Blog Tagging is relatively a new game going around the blogosphere. The rules are simple, just share five things about yourself (or your blog) and then tag 5 of your favorite bloggers and encourage them to play.

I was inspired to play blog tagging by Quick Online Tips. So far, I’ve been Tagged by TechZ, Hans, Chris Cree, Sujan, Lovedeep, Santosh, Ashish, Ibrahim Ali Faour and ofcource Quick Online Tips. Thanks!

5 Things you never knew about my blog:

1. This blog started off as my storage (or what your call as bookmarking) for all cool sites I found across the web.

2. The pagerank on this blog jumped directly from 0 to 6, I would like to thank all those who linked to me.

3. This blog made me quit my studies and take up full time blogging (This was done against my parents wise & will, I have no regrets for what I’ve done)

4. Majority of my visitors come from Google and StumbleUpon. They come searching for “Bebo” and “Vista Transformation Pack”

5. This blog recorded an all time high traffic on October 18th. (37,079 Unique Visitors, Current average is 6,845 per day)
